How much do sale rep jobs pay per year?

As of Jun 4, 2026, the average yearly pay for sale rep in the United States is $76,681.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$53,500.00 and $93,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Sales Representative,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Sales Representative, you need strong communication, negotiation, and customer relationship-building skills, often supported by a background in business or sales. Familiarity with customer relationship management (CRM) software, sales tracking tools, and product knowledge is typically expected. Persistence, active listening, and resilience are standout soft skills in this role. These skills are crucial for meeting sales targets, maintaining client satisfaction, and driving business growth.

What are some common challenges Sales Representatives face when trying to meet their targets, and how can they overcome them?

Sales Representatives often encounter challenges such as handling customer objections, managing a fluctuating sales pipeline, and staying motivated during slow periods. To overcome these, successful sales reps focus on building strong relationships, thoroughly understanding their products, and regularly updating their knowledge of market trends. They also benefit from collaborating closely with team members for support and sharing best practices, and by leveraging CRM tools to stay organized and track progress toward their goals.

What does a Sales Representative do?

A Sales Representative is responsible for selling products or services to customers on behalf of a company. They identify potential clients, present and demonstrate products, negotiate deals, and maintain relationships with existing customers. Sales representatives play a crucial role in achieving a company's revenue goals and often work towards sales targets or quotas. Their work may involve traveling, attending trade shows, and staying informed about industry trends.

What is the difference between Sale Rep vs Customer Service Representative?

AspectSale RepCustomer Service Representative
Required CredentialsHigh school diploma; sales experienceHigh school diploma; communication skills
Work EnvironmentSales offices, client sitesCall centers, retail stores
Employer & Industry UsageSales-focused companies across industriesCustomer support across various sectors
Common Search & ComparisonSales roles, commission-based jobsCustomer support, client relations

While both roles involve interaction with clients, a Sale Rep primarily focuses on selling products or services and generating revenue, often working in sales environments. In contrast, a Customer Service Representative emphasizes assisting customers, resolving issues, and maintaining satisfaction. The roles may overlap in communication skills but differ in objectives and daily tasks.
